Job title: IT Support Specialist
This role is required to work US Timezone so will be night shifts..
Responsibilities:
- Report to the Regional IT Manager and cover the Americas regions for IT support.
- Prepare, inventory and deploy end-users laptops/workstations across Europe.
- Perform system administration and provide second line user support.
- Be responsible of the good working of end-user IT assets in Europe region.
- Diagnose & document hardware & software problems (building a knowledge base)
- Use problem-solving skills to fix immediate hardware/software problems as well as to define long term problem solutions.
- Assist the IT Manager to implement corporate IT projects
- Application and user account/profile administration
- Prepare relevant documentation and production changes
- Improve security on/out the IT network
- Constant hardware/software inventory update and maintain local system configuration.
- Perform pro-active actions on all services and identify possible blocking points & bottlenecks.
- Implement projects to meet requirements and standards in a timely and professional manner.
- Provide skill transfers to other team members.
- Performs mi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ned.
- Act as the main onsite engineer in charge of the Herndon Office in USA for all end-users
Requirements:
- Degree in Computer Science or related discipline.
- Fast learner, team player.
- Extensive knowledge of LAN/WAN technology, VPN, SD WAN, etc.
- Basic knowledge on Linux/Unix OS (Centos/RedHat) & Windows 2016+ server.
- Good knowledge on Apple computers.
- Basic knowledge in open source solutions (Open LDAP, Postfix, …)
- Knowledge about Google Workspace, JumpCloud, Saviynt, Zoom.
- Able to provide technical solutions and alternatives from high level requirements
- Able to complete task at a timely manner
- Strong trouble-shooting and problem solving skills.
- Proven ability to keep track of multiple tasks and projects at once.
- Strong written and verbal communication in English
- Independent, mature, initiative and is able to produce high quality deliverables under tight schedule.
- Ability to work effectively and accurately under pressure and to work in continually changing environments.
